February 4: TVL Surpasses $500 Million

Less than a year after its mainnet launch, Sui’s Total Value Locked (TVL) exceeded $500 million, placing it among the top ten blockchain networks. This rapid growth highlighted Sui’s strong appeal to DeFi projects and users.

March 1: Stablecoin USDY Launches on Sui

Ondo Finance introduced USDY, a yield-bearing stablecoin, marking the arrival of the first dollar-pegged token on Sui. This launch reflected growing institutional confidence in the Sui ecosystem.

March 19: Sui Gaming Summit

During the Game Developers Conference in San Francisco, Sui hosted a gaming event to showcase upcoming titles and attract more developers to the Web3 space.

April 3: Move 2024 Edition Beta Release

The Move programming language received a major update with the 2024 Edition, introducing new capabilities such as method syntax, field positioning, and loop labels. These enhancements provided developers with greater flexibility and power.

April 10: Sui Basecamp Event

Sui held its flagship annual event, Sui Basecamp, during Paris Blockchain Week. The two-day conference attracted over 1,100 participants from 65 countries, serving as a hub for networking and innovation.

April 21: Sui Overflow Hackathon

Sui organized its largest global hackathon to date, which spanned two months and featured 352 project submissions. A total of 32 teams were awarded across 8 competition categories.

May 3: First Anniversary of Mainnet Launch

Sui celebrated one year since its mainnet went live. Key first-year accomplishments included breakthroughs like zkLogin and DeepBook, as well as record-breaking metrics such as 65 million daily transactions.

June 18: Introduction of Walrus

Mysten Labs announced Walrus, a decentralized data storage network that uses Sui as its coordination layer. This development positioned Sui at the forefront of data network innovation.

August 6: Mysticeti Consensus Mechanism Unveiled

Sui’s engineering team introduced Mysticeti, a new consensus mechanism designed to enhance performance—especially for low-latency processing of shared object transactions.

September 2: SuiPlay0X1 Gaming Device Revealed

At Korea Blockchain Week, Sui unveiled SuiPlay0X1, a mobile device built for Web3 gaming. It allows users to seamlessly connect and manage their in-game assets.

September 5: Stablecoin AUSD Goes Live

Agora launched its native dollar stablecoin on Sui, offering DeFi users more options for trading and exchange within the growing Sui economy.

September 29: TVL Exceeds $1 Billion

Driven by leading DeFi protocols and increasing user adoption, Sui’s TVL surpassed $1 billion. By the time of publication, it had already reached over $1.7 billion.

September 30: Sui Bridge Launched

Sui released a new native bridge enabling cross-chain transfers between SUI and Ethereum, with plans to expand support for more assets and blockchains.

October 8: USDC Stablecoin Arrives on Sui

Circle’s USDC stablecoin launched on Sui, providing a fully collateralized dollar-backed asset and enhancing liquidity across the ecosystem.

October 14: DeepBook Introduces DEEP Token

The release of the DEEP token introduced a new governance model for DeepBook, Sui’s native liquidity layer, enabling community voting on protocol parameters.

November 14: SuiNS Transitions to Decentralization

Sui Name Service became community-run and decentralized, accompanied by the launch of the NS governance token.

November 20: FDUSD Stablecoin Launches on Sui

First Digital Labs brought its FDUSD stablecoin to Sui as a native asset—the fourth major stablecoin added to the network in 2024.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the Sui Network?
Sui is a decentralized Layer-1 blockchain designed for high throughput, low latency, and scalable smart contracts. It uses the Move programming language and focuses on superior user and developer experience.

What makes Sui different from other blockchains?
Sui offers parallel transaction processing, innovative consensus mechanisms, and native support for composable digital assets. These features allow it to achieve high speed and scalability without sacrificing security.
